Ticket: Crashfall ingest failing on staging

New folks, please read carefully. The Pebblekit mobile app's crash reports aren't reaching the symbolication queue because staging's env file was copied without its upload credential. Symptoms: 401s in the collector logs every five minutes. To fix, add the missing line to the env file, exactly as follows.

secret setting of fafop-tagep: VAULT_KEY29=6a815d21e2d77cc25ef1802d73ee6

**FAQ: Weekend lift maintenance at Brindlehurst House**

On the second weekend of each month, Vantrell Lift Services takes both passenger lifts out of service from Saturday 07:00 until Sunday 15:00. Team assistants booking weekend meetings should route visitors to the east stairwell and reserve ground-floor rooms where possible. The goods lift remains available for urgent deliveries, but it requires an escort from the duty facilities officer. If you need to open the stairwell fire doors for access, use the code below.

staff pass of haduf-yagaf = bdg-DBSQF-1

## Session Handling for Health Checks

The Corvel gateway sits behind the Lanternside load balancer, which probes /healthz every ten seconds. Health-check requests are stateless by design: they bypass the session store entirely so that probe traffic never inflates session counts or evicts real user sessions. New team members should note that the deep-check endpoint, /healthz/deep, does verify session-store connectivity and therefore requires authentication. When probing it manually, supply the token below.

bearer token for tajep-kajef: eyJhbGciOiJIUzI1NiIsInR5cCI6IkpXVCJ9.eyJzdWIiOiIoOsZ23In0.CsygO0hs